Engine & Transmission

The Ford Taurus boasts a powerful 245-hp EcoBoost engine paired with an 8-speed automatic transmission. Its twin-scroll turbocharged engine delivers impressive torque and acceleration. The Taurus features independent suspension and advanced safety features for a comfortable and confident driving experience.

Specs-
Rating
Powertrain ArchitectureInternal Combustion engine
Power245 Hp @ 5500 rpm.
Power Per Litre122.6 Hp/l
Torque390 Nm @ 2500-3500 rpm. 287.65 lb.-ft. @ 2500-3500 rpm.
Engine LayoutFront, Transverse
Engine Model CodeEcoBoost
Engine Displacement1999 cm3 121.99 cu. in.
Number Of Cylinders4
Engine ConfigurationInline
Number Of Valves Per Cylinder4
Fuel Injection SystemDirect injection
Engine AspirationTwin-scroll turbo, Intercooler
Engine Oil Capacity5.2 l 5.49 US qt | 4.58 UK qt
Engine Oil Specification5W-30 / Ford WSS-M2C946-B1
Coolant9.4 l 9.93 US qt | 8.27 UK qt
Drivetrain ArchitectureThe Internal combustion engine (ICE) drives the front wheels of the vehicle.
Drive WheelFront wheel drive
Number Of Gears And Type Of Gearbox8 gears, automatic transmission
Front SuspensionIndependent type McPherson
Rear SuspensionIndependent multi-link suspension
Engine SystemsStart & Stop System
